Impressive tunnels dug in the Rock of Gibraltar.
They were dug in the Rock by the fireworks of His Majesty's army to defend the site at the end of the th century.
An impressive network of over 50 km, which was completed during the Second World War to serve as weapons and HQ storage prior to the invasion of North Africa by allied troops commanded by General Eisenhower.
